Member Duties : The support members offer their assigned schools will consist of regular in-person and virtual training and troubleshooting sessions with the team coaches, observation of after-school sessions to provide students with additional insights and tips, and logistical support of the teams in their portfolio when they attend Chicago Debates' tournaments. Undertaking these service activities will provide multiple opportunities for leadership and skill development.
